What is DeviceUpdate.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file stores code and data that many programs can use. It contains functions and procedures that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. Specific to 'DeviceUpdate.dll,' it is a file that helps manage and update devices connected to a computer.

In the case of 'Sony PC Companion,' DeviceUpdate.dll plays a vital role in ensuring that the software can communicate with and update Sony devices such as smartphones and tablets. The DeviceUpdate.dll file is important for Sony PC Companion because it provides the necessary functions for the software to recognize and interact with Sony devices. Without this DLL file, Sony PC Companion would not be able to perform vital tasks such as updating device software and managing files on Sony devices.

Therefore, DeviceUpdate.dll is crucial for the smooth operation of Sony PC Companion and the overall user experience when using Sony devices with this software.

D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.

  • DeviceUpdate.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.
  • DeviceUpdate.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
  • This application failed to start because DeviceUpdate.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error is thrown when a necessary DLL file is not found by the application. It might have been accidentally deleted or misplaced. Reinstallation of the application can possibly resolve this issue by replacing the missing DLL file.
  • The file DeviceUpdate.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
  • DeviceUpdate.dll not found: This indicates that the application you're trying to run is looking for a specific DLL file that it can't locate. This could be due to the DLL file being missing, corrupted, or incorrectly installed.

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the DeviceUpdate.dll Errors

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the DeviceUpdate.dll Errors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
6
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
3
Description

In this guide, we will aim to resolve issues related to DeviceUpdate.dll by utilizing the (DISM) tool.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run DISM Scan

Step 2: Run DISM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th and press Enter.

  2. Allow the Deployment Image Servicing and Management tool to scan your system and correct any errors it detects.

Step 3: Review Results

Step 3: Review Results Thumbnail
  1. Review the results once the scan is completed.
